Hristo Velev has a great series for introducing basic workflow between Naiad and 3ds MAX with nine tutorials for creating simulations between the two applications. Starting out with basic workflow between Naiad and 3ds MAX, then moving on and covering topics such as Color Mapping by Velocity, Coloring normals from Meshes in Naiad, Creating Point Attractors, and Coloring Frost and Krakatoa with Naiad.

Naiad is Exotic Matter a high end fluid dynamics and simulation software. Naiad’s dynamics solver and simulation framework capable of producing animations of dynamic bodies such as liquids (including large and small bodies of water, breaking waves, and splashes and foam) and gases (including fire, smoke and explosions). Naiad also has full two-way coupling of rigid bodies to fluids.
